using System; using System.IO; namespace Hcs.ClientApi { /// /// Поток байтов который является частью другого потока байтов /// https://stackoverflow.com/questions/60592147/partial-stream-of-filestream /// public class HcsPartialStream : Stream { public Stream Stream { get; private set; } public long StreamStart { get; private set; } public long StreamLength { get; private set; } public long StreamEnd { get; private set; } public HcsPartialStream(Stream stream, long offset, long size) { Stream = stream; StreamStart = offset; StreamLength = size; StreamEnd = offset + size; stream.Seek(offset, SeekOrigin.Begin); } public override bool CanRead => true; public override bool CanSeek => false; public override bool CanWrite => false; public override long Length => Math.Min((Stream.Length - StreamStart), StreamLength); public override long Position { get => Stream.Position - StreamStart; set => Stream.Position = StreamStart + value; } public override void Flush() { throw new NotImplementedException(); } public override int Read(byte[] buffer, int offset, int count) { var p = Stream.Position; if (p < StreamStart) { Stream.Position = StreamStart; } if (p > StreamEnd) { return 0; } if (p + count > StreamEnd) { count = (int)(StreamEnd - p); } return Stream.Read(buffer, offset, count); } public override long Seek(long offset, SeekOrigin origin) { // Seek will be complicated as there are three origin types. // You can do it yourself. throw new NotImplementedException(); } public override void SetLength(long value) { throw new NotImplementedException(); } public override void Write(byte[] buffer, int offset, int count) { throw new NotImplementedException(); } } }
